
MDI High School Receives Grant to Cover Most of Cost of an Electric School Bus
According to the Portland Press Herald MDI High School has been awarded a grant of $280,000 to nearly cover the cost of a new $300,000 electric school bus.
The money comes from Volkswagen and the emission scandal settlement. In that settlement, Volkswagen agreed to pay $14.7 billion nationally toward pollution mitigation
According to the article Thomas Built Buses, an industry leader, estimates an electric school bus can save $4,400 a year in maintenance and $2,000 in fuel, compared to diesel. Plus there's the elimination of green house gases.
The e-bus at MDI will be the first electric school bus in Maine
